Enforcement Analysis

According to U.S. Department of Labor enforcement records, MERCHANTS METALS DIVISION OF MMI PRODUCTS — a other construction material merchant wholesalers facility located at 5454 N. WASHINGTON ST., BLDG. B, DENVER, CO 80216 — was the subject of a formal OSHA inspection that resulted in 24 citation(s) and cumulative proposed penalties of $3,560.00. The inspection case was opened on 2005-03-02.

BLS Injury Data: According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(2022), this industry sector has an occupational injury rate of 2.6 per 100 full-time workers — near the national average of 2.7. The sector fatality rate is 4.4 per 100,000 workers.

Industry Benchmark: The total penalty of $3,560.00 is 31% below the national average of $5,185.75 for facilities in the Wholesale sector (NAICS 423390). This sector encompasses 30,869 inspected facilities nationwide with aggregate penalties totaling $160.1M.

State Context: Within CO, this facility's penalty places it at the 77th percentile among 32,935 inspected facilities. The statewide average penalty is $3,271.13.

Citation Analysis: The inspection produced 24 citations spanning 5 distinct OSHA regulatory standards. The citation breakdown includes: 14 serious — A workplace hazard that could cause death or serious physical harm exists, and the employer knew or should have known about the condition. 1 other-than-serious — The violation has a direct relationship to job safety and health but is unlikely to cause death or serious physical harm.

Enforcement Timeline: Citations were issued beginning May 27, 2005 with the latest abatement deadline set for August 5, 2005. Of the 24 total citations, 10 (42%) have been marked as abated in DOL records, which may indicate ongoing compliance gaps requiring further regulatory attention.
